Pioneer Memorial Cemetery ~ Ural M. Smith
Print Friendly Version
Smith, Ural M.
LAST: Smith FIRST: Ural MID: M.
GENDER: M MAIDEN NAME:  TITLE: 
BORN: 17 Apr 1895 DIED: 9 Jun 1959 BURIED: 
OCCUPATION:  Auto Mechanic
BIRTH PLACE:  Parkersville, Marion Co., Oregon
DEATH PLACE: Portland, Multnomah Co., Oregon
NOTES: 
1900 OR CENSUS - Ural Smith, age 5, b. Apr 1895 in Oregon, is enumerated with father Joseph Smith, age 36, ocupation farmer, b. Jul 1863 in Missouri, and mother Ettie, age 27, mother of 7 children 6 of whom are living at the time of the census, b. Jan 1873 in Oregon, along with Vida, age 10, b. Aug 1889 in Oregon, Orrie, age 7, b. Feb 1893 in Oregon, and Everett, age 10 months, b. July 1899 in Oregon. Also enumerated with the family is Elsie Smith, identified as mother [of Joseph], age 65, widowed, b. Mar 1835 in Missouri, and Ronald Esson, identifed as a boarder, age 24, occupation day laborer, b. Jan 1876 in Oregon.
1910 CENSUS - Ural Smith, age 14, b. Oregon is enumerated with Joseph L., age 47, farmer, b. Missouri, and Etta, age 37, the mother of 10 children, 8 of whom are living at the time of the census, b. Oregon, along with siblings Vida, age 19, Orris, age 17, Everett, age 10, Marie, age 8, Mina, age 6, Ruth, age 4, and Douglas, age 2, all born in Oregon. Also enumerated with the family is Jane Smith identified as mother [of Joseph], age 79. b. Missouri.
1930 CENSUS - Ural Smith, age 35, occupation auto mechanic, b. Oregon, is enumerated with his wife Cecile, age 29. b. Wyoming, along with Devere, age 12, and Arnold, age 10, both born in Oregon.
OBITUARY: 
Ural Smith’s Rites Friday.
PARKERSVILLE (Special) - Funeral services will be held Friday for Ural M. Smith, 64, former Parkersville resident who died Tuesday in a Portland hospital. Born April 17, 1895, at Parkersville, he is survived by sons DeVere and Arnold Smith, both of Portland, and several brothers and sisters.
Services will be held at 1 p.m. Friday at Tigard Funeral Home,
Tigard, with graveside services at Pioneer Cemetery here.
[newspaper clipping, not cited]
INSCRIPTION: 
The Smith Family
Ural M. 1895-1959
[shares marker with several other Smith family members]
